Is there any reason they only allow 4 traditional Irish banks (none of which I use for good reasons) rather than letting us link all already available banks from other countries? I don’t think the open banking APIs are different in each country. So once a bank has been added for one country, it should also be possible to link it in another country.

APIs for PSD2 XS2A (access to account) are vastly different. There’s no international standard at all (PSD2 defines what should be available, not how). The UK introduced a national quasi standard (called the Open Banking Initiative, but it’s not mandatory for all banks but the largest ones to use this specific standard), and other countries have national standards like the Berlin Group for Germany. That’s where account aggregators come into play. They fetch the data via divers APIs from banks, unify it and provide them to Revolut. Revolut relies on Truelayer. And what Revolut can do depends on Truelayers list of supported banks.
